Ditch the Deception: The Protein Bar Reality Check
For years, protein bars have been sold as a convenient solution for fitness enthusiasts. Filled with protein, they promised to help you reach your fitness goals. But are these bars truly as healthy as advertised? The reality might surprise you.
- Many protein bars contain high amounts of sugar, unhealthy fats, and artificial ingredients.
- Don't be fooled by flashy packaging; you need to carefully read the nutrition label to find a truly healthy protein bar.
- Whole foods should always be your primary source of protein.
Keep in mind that protein bars are a supplement, not a substitute for a balanced diet.
Achieve Your Fitness Goals with the Right Protein Bar
Protein bars have become a popular choice for people looking to enhance their fitness plan. However, not all protein bars are created equal. Choosing the right bar can make a major difference in your potential to attain your fitness goals.
Here's why selecting a high-quality protein bar is essential:
* It provides a easy source of calories after a training session.
* The proper protein bar can support muscle growth.
* Many protein bars also contain essential vitamins and minerals that enhance your overall health.
When selecting a protein bar, consider the listed factors:
* Protein content: Aim for a bar with at least 10 grams of protein per serving.
* Sugar content: Choose bars that are low in added sugars.
* Ingredients list: Opt bars made with natural ingredients.
By choosing a protein bar that meets your needs, you can effectively support your fitness journey and achieve your goals.
Homemade vs. Commercial: Which Protein Bar Rules?
Whether you're a fitness fanatic or just craving a quick and healthy snack, protein bars have become a staple in many diets. But when it comes to choosing between homemade and store-bought options, the decision can be tough.
Homemade protein bars allow you to dictate every ingredient, ensuring they're made with quality ingredients and without any added sugar you might want to avoid. You can play around with different flavors and textures, making them a truly custom treat.
On the other hand, store-bought protein bars offer ease. They're readily available at most grocery stores and offer numerous flavors and types to satisfy any craving. ,Furthermore, many commercial brands boast high protein content per bar, making them a solid pick for post-workout recovery or a quick energy boost.
Ultimately, the best choice depends on your individual goals.
If you value control over ingredients and enjoy the act of cooking, homemade protein bars might be the way to go. But if ease of access is a priority, store-bought options provide a satisfying and protein-packed solution.
